Wasola (zip 65773), Missouri gets a BestPlaces Cost of Living score of 81.7, which means the total cost of housing, food, childcare, transportation, healthcare, taxes, and other necessities is 18.3% lower than the U.S. average and 4.6% higher than the average for Missouri.

Zip 65773 (Wasola, MO)

Housing costs in Wasola?
A typical home costs $205,600, which is 39.2% less expensive than the national average of $338,100 and 3.2% less expensive than the average Missouri home, at $212,300. Renting a two-bedroom unit in Wasola costs $820 per month, which is 42.7% cheaper than the national average of $1,430 and 15.9% cheaper than the state average of $950.

Can I afford Wasola?
To live comfortably in Wasola (zip 65773), Missouri, a minimum annual income of $39,240 for a family, and $24,800 for a single person is recommended.
